Transaction 57d1073387e35b1c1e0f270c1ebef253645a18b42edaa61c2b8d1a33594b5eba

1 Input
2 Outputs
  • 57d1073387e35b1c1e0f270c1ebef253645a18b42edaa61c2b8d1a33594b5eba:0
  • value  533100
    address  346acmSmXFd2F41dghSYXbm53zErcRhxpk
  • 57d1073387e35b1c1e0f270c1ebef253645a18b42edaa61c2b8d1a33594b5eba:1
  • value  581843903
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k